Understanding Your Face Shape
Before we dive into the myriad of haircuts, it's crucial to understand that not every style suits every face shape. Your haircut should complement your features, not compete with them. Here's a quick guide to help you identify your face shape:
- Oval: Proportionate with features in harmony, oval faces can pull off almost any style.
- Round: Characterized by full cheeks and a width-to-length ratio of about 1:1, round faces look best with styles that add height or draw the eye upward.
- Square: With a strong jawline and broad forehead, square faces benefit from styles that soften angular features.
- Oblong: Longer than they are wide, oblong faces look best with styles that add width or draw the eye horizontally.
- Diamond: Narrow at the forehead and jaw, with high cheekbones, diamond-shaped faces look best with styles that add width at the temples or sides.
Timeless Classics: The Foundation of Our Archive
Every man's haircut archive should start with the classics. These styles have stood the test of time, offering a solid foundation for your grooming journey.

The Buzz Cut
A symbol of simplicity and low maintenance, the buzz cut is a versatile style that works for all face shapes. It's a bold choice, emphasizing your features and showcasing your personality.
The Side Part
Elegant and sophisticated, the side part is a classic style that adds a touch of formality. It works best for those with straight or wavy hair and can be dressed up or down depending on the occasion.
The Crew Cut
Similar to the buzz cut but with more length on top, the crew cut is a smart, preppy style that's perfect for those who want a neat, polished look. It's a great choice for those with fine or thinning hair, as it adds the illusion of thickness.

Trending Styles: The Evolution of Our Archive
Fashion is cyclical, and men's haircuts are no exception. Here are some of the latest trends making waves in our archive:
The Man Bun
Once a symbol of rebellion, the man bun has evolved into a mainstream style. It's a bold choice that requires length and thickness, but when done right, it's a striking look that turns heads.
The Fade
A modern take on the classic high-top fade of the '90s, the fade is a versatile style that works for all face shapes. It involves tapering the sides and back of the hair, leaving more length on top for styling.

The Undercut
Similar to the fade, the undercut involves shaving the sides and back of the hair, but unlike the fade, the undercut is typically more dramatic, with a clear line of demarcation between the short and long hair.
Haircuts for Specific Face Shapes
As mentioned earlier, the right haircut can enhance your features, while the wrong one can detract from them. Here are some styles that work best for specific face shapes:
Round Faces
Styles that add height or draw the eye upward are best for round faces. Consider a pompadour, quiff, or textured crop to elongate your face and balance out your features.
Square Faces
Soft, rounded styles work best for square faces. A textured fringe, side-swept style, or curly cut can help soften your angular features and create a more harmonious look.
Oblong Faces
Styles that add width or draw the eye horizontally are best for oblong faces. A side part, layered cut, or textured fringe can help create the illusion of width and balance out your features.
Diamond Faces
Styles that add width at the temples or sides are best for diamond faces. A side-swept fringe, layered cut, or textured style can help create the illusion of width and balance out your high cheekbones.
